Typically priced at only $0. 12* per square foot, this is one of the most cost-effective construction materials out there. The flexibility of the film makes it easy to install. Maintenance of the film, on the other hand, is somewhat arduous. The plastic needs to be hosed down every now and then and inspected regularly for punctures.


In the case where the film is torn or punctured from multiple points, you’ll need to replace it with a new one (Greenhouse construction). As plants use heat as fuel for photosynthesis, materials with high heat conductivity, such as glass, are ideal for the construction of greenhouses. When sunlight strikes the surface of the glass, solar energy is converted into infrared energy, which then increases the temperature inside the structure and allows plants to thrive


PVC is yet another material that’s both economical, light-weight and easy to handle. It may not be as sturdy as metal frames, but it is certainly more resistant to corrosion than wood and can last for up to 20 years with UV protection. A PVC pipe that’s 1. 5” in diameter can cost up to $0.


Commercial greenhouses with steel frames should be the go-to choice of those who prioritize durability and sturdiness. These frames are highly robust, low-maintenance, and capable of lasting through adverse conditions. Steel Buildings are available at a rate of $7-$12* per sf. Caterpillar tunnels and hoop houses are similar because they have sturdy internal support. However, caterpillar tunnels use anchored ropes for support. Hoop houses have strong enough frames to stand on their own. Check out our selection of shade cloth! Think of a caterpillar tunnel like a large tent. Despite the internal framework, it still needs extra external support.


Hoop houses often rely on passive heating and ventilation. The inside of the building is warmed or cooled by the outdoor weather conditions. Roll-up walls control airflow. Some hoop houses pop over to this site may have ridge vents that enable airflow. You can build a hoop house right on top of your crops - it doesn't need a solid floor.


Greenhouses are the more durable, permanent counterpart to hoop houses. They may be similar to hoop houses, but the former can have greenhouse plastic, polycarbonate, and glass covers. Greenhouses enjoy more high-tech heating and cooling options also. Active heating and ventilation are often built-in to these buildings. Some greenhouses even have furnaces and boilers to provide extra heating.


You don't have to do this manually, go now though -greenhouses can accommodate automated systems. A greenhouse offers better protection because it's more enclosed than a hoop house. They have foundations and end walls, so pests and soil disease have a harder time infiltrating your crops. You'll have to spend more money to build a greenhouse because you're constructing a permanent building.

A greenhouse end wall is what it sounds like. The end walls are the walls at each end of the building. The end walls are where you'll find the entry, as well as optional items like vents and fans. The difference between hoop houses and greenhouses is that hoop houses don't need foundations or complex end walls.


Greenhouse end wall design is probably the best part of building somewhere to put your gardens and crops. There's not a lot of wiggle room in designing the main building, but you can customize the end walls a bit. After all, you have to consider what your end walls will look like and what you need them to do.


PE film won't offer much strength or durability to your hoop house's overall structure. Polyethylene doesn't have much wind or heat resistance either. Aside from this, polyethylene will work fine as an end wall covering if you don't live in a windy or hot location. It's cheap and can offer moderate protection in milder climates.


Polycarbonate is easy to use and doesn't require much upkeep. Unlike PE film, polycarbonate is sturdier and can offer more stability for hoop houses. When combined with metal frames, polycarbonate-covered end walls can withstand high winds, snow, rain, and other kinds of weather. The material is strong and still offers protection from pests and moisture.

The Relevance of Organic Fertilizers in Plant Top Quality



You need to comprehend the relevance of making use of organic fertilizers to improve the high quality of your plants. Organic fertilizers are derived from natural resources such as pet manure, garden compost, and also plant deposits. Unlike synthetic plant foods, natural fertilizers offer vital nutrients to your plants in a slow-release fashion, making certain a steady supply of nourishment gradually. This aids to advertise healthy and balanced and also strenuous growth, resulting in higher plant returns.


One of the vital benefits of organic plant foods is that they boost soil structure and also fertility. They include organic issue that improves soil moisture retention, aeration, and also nutrient-holding capability. This develops a favorable setting for helpful soil microorganisms like bacteria, earthworms, as well as fungi, which play a vital function in damaging down organic issue as well as releasing nutrients for your plants.


Using organic plant foods additionally lowers the risk of chemical deposits in your crops. Synthetic plant foods, on the other hand, may leave unsafe residues that can impact human health and wellness and the atmosphere. By choosing organic plant foods, you are choosing a much safer as well as more lasting strategy to farming.


Additionally, organic plant foods contribute to the long-lasting wellness of your dirt. They enrich the soil with organic matter, which boosts soil fertility as well as assists to stop soil disintegration. Healthy and balanced dirt is the foundation for healthy plants, and also by nurturing your dirt with natural fertilizers, you are making certain the longevity and performance of your crops.

Yard is lawn, right? Well, not fairly. There are numerous kinds of turf, as well as each one requires a various degree of care. Some turf kinds will certainly grow in your region's climate, while others will battle to survive. Turf types fall into two classifications: Cool-season yards and also warm-season lawns. grow best in North states, where winters months are lengthy and also summertimes are mild.


Warm-season turfs prefer cozy temperature levels and actively grow in summer season. In autumn, warm-season grasses get in dormancy when temperature levels drop listed below 65 levels and green up once more in spring.


In the transition area, if you have an eco-friendly yard in summer season, your lawn has warm-season grass. If your lawn is brownish in summer season, it's expanding go right here cool-season turf.


Your grass requires three essential nutrients to flourish: Nitrogen (N), phosphorus (P), as well as potassium (K). Arise from a laboratory soil test will typically advise an N-P-K proportion that's ideal for your dirt. Most fertilizers will note the N-P-K ratio on the label. If a fertilizer bundle lists the numbers 25-10-15, that indicates the fertilizer consists of 25% nitrogen, 10% phosphorus, and also 15% potassium.

Poor sprinkling routines can prove detrimental to your yard's health and wellness. If you keep the adhering to watering ideas in mind, your lawn's wellness will be right on the right track: The majority of developed yards need depending on the turf type., ideally before 8 a.Watering frequently and for brief periods motivates a superficial, weak origin system. It's far better to water your grass deeply as soon as a week than water it quickly 3 times a week. If your turf transforms grayish-blue or your impacts are visible on the grass, after that your grass requires a drink.Aeration might seem like a health club therapy, but that's because it is one for your yard. Aeration soothes compact dirt and allows your turf's roots a lot of access to water, oxygen, and nutrients. An aerator is a tool you push similar to a mower. The aerator draws little plugs of dirt from the ground to create holes in the grass.
